SCHEDULE 13G: Alyeska Investment Group Discloses 5.34% Passive Stake in Wayfair Inc.

Sentiment:

Beneficial Ownership Report


Alyeska Investment Group, L.P., along with Alyeska Fund GP, LLC and Anand Parekh, has disclosed a passive beneficial ownership of 5.34% in Wayfair Inc.'s Class A Common Stock.

Summary

  • Alyeska Investment Group, L.P., Alyeska Fund GP, LLC, and Anand Parekh collectively reported beneficial ownership of 5,462,651 shares of Wayfair Inc.'s Class A Common Stock.
  • This ownership represents 5.34% of Wayfair Inc.'s outstanding Class A Common Stock.
  • The shares were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business, not for the purpose of changing or influencing the control of Wayfair Inc.
  • The beneficial ownership calculation is based on 103,657,178 outstanding shares of Wayfair Inc. Common Stock as of April 24, 2025, as reported in Wayfair's Form 10-Q filed May 1, 2025.
  • The filing was made under Rule 13d-1(b), indicating a passive investment intent.

Next Steps

  • The reporting persons will be required to file amendments to this Schedule 13G if there are material changes to their beneficial ownership or investment intent.

Key Dates

DateDescription
03/31/2025Date of event which required the filing of this statement (crossing the 5% ownership threshold).
04/24/2025Date as of which the beneficial ownership of 5,462,651 shares was calculated.
05/01/2025Date Wayfair Inc. filed its Form 10-Q, providing the basis for the total outstanding shares used in the percentage calculation.
05/15/2025Date the Schedule 13G filing was signed by the reporting persons.
